|
Investments, Debt and Equity Securities (Tables)
|6 Months Ended
Jun. 29, 2024
|Investments, Debt and Equity Securities [Abstract]
|Schedule of Available-for-sale Securities Reconciliation
|
The following table summarizes available-for-sale debt securities held at June 29, 2024 and December 31, 2023 by asset type:
|Investments Classified by Contractual Maturity Date
|
The net carrying values of available-for-sale debt securities at June 29, 2024 by contractual maturity, are shown below. Expected maturities may differ from contractual maturities because the issuers of the securities may have the right to prepay obligations without prepayment penalties.
|X
- Definition
+ References
Tabular disclosure of maturities of an entity's investments as well as any other information pertinent to the investments.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Tabular disclosure of the reconciliation of available-for-sale securities from cost basis to fair value.
+ Details
No definition available.